a.js

export var name="李四";

或者:

a.js

var name1="李四";
var name2="张三";
export { name1 ,name2 }
// 以上在a.js里
// 以下vue里使用 import { name1 , name2 } from "/.a.js" //路径根据你的实际情况填写
export default {
data () {
return { }
},
created:function(){
alert(name1)//可以弹出来“李四”
alert(name2)//可以弹出来“张三”
}
}

export跟export default 有什么区别呢?如下:

1、export与export default均可用于导出常量、函数、文件、模块等
2、你可以在其它文件或模块中通过import+(常量 | 函数 | 文件 | 模块)名的方式,将其导入,以便能够对其进行使用
3、在一个文件或模块中,export、import可以有多个,export default仅有一个
4、通过export方式导出,在导入时要加{ },export default则不需要

var name="李四";
export { name }
//import { name } from "/.a.js" // export 可以多个,import 则用大括号
可以写成:
var name="李四";
export default name
//import name from "/.a.js" 这里name不需要大括号

转自:

https://www.cnblogs.com/xiaotanke/p/7448383.html

最新文章

  1. Unity Animator动画状态机 深入理解(一)
  2. [问题记录.dotnet]取网卡信息报错"找不到"-WMI - Not found
  3. [蓝牙] 3、 剖析BLE心率检测工程
  4. 电商CRM的痛点在哪里?
  5. LTE Module User Documentation(翻译13)——频率复用算法(Frequency Reuse Algorithms)
  6. iOS 检查版本号的代码
  7. iOS进阶学习-数据处理之文件读写
  8. WebSocket学习
  9. Delphi TcxTreeListColumn 的 ImageComboBox 用法
  10. FloatingActionButton 完全解析[Design Support Library(2)]
  11. 【深圳,武汉】一加科技(One Plus)招聘,寻找不...
  12. 简述java程序中的main方法
  13. Aras简单报表
  14. ECMA Script 6_数组的扩展_扩展运算符
  15. Go 初体验 - 并发与锁.2 - sync.WaitGroup
  16. 10Linux_firewalld-Linux就该这么学
  17. Cobbler自动化批量安装Linux操作系统 - 运维总结
  18. Python基础(函数部分)-day04
  19. iOS8中 UILocalNotification 和 UIRemoteNotification 使用注意
  20. [Algorithm] Polynomial and FFT

热门文章

  1. python3 操作 hive 安装依赖包整理
  2. SpringBoot 注册Servlet三大组件【Servlet、Filter、Listener】-原生代码+@Bean+效果展示
  3. Vue钩子函数
  4. PHP——获取当前时间精确到毫秒(yyyyMMddHHmmssSSS)
  5. jpg/jpeg/png格式的区别与应用场景
  6. go实现多聊天并发 服务端
  7. 动态加载 ShellCode绕过杀软
  8. PHP操作数据库(以MySQL为例)
  9. 2-STM32+W5500+GPRS物联网开发基础篇-基础篇学习的内容
  10. kafka Auto offset commit faild reblance